What Makes an MSP an Industry Expert

Establishing authority in the industry starts with demonstrating expertise. For MSPs, this means building trust through a clear display of skills and knowledge.

Key Traits of Industry Expertise

Industry expertise comes from a combination of advanced technical skills, practical IT service experience, and a solid professional reputation.

Experts often share their knowledge through blogs, webinars, or speaking events. This not only highlights their skills but also builds credibility.

Clear communication is another essential skill. The ability to explain complex technical ideas to both decision-makers and IT professionals sets exceptional MSPs apart. Those who can bridge the gap between technical and business discussions are better equipped to stand out.

Why Specialization Matters

Focusing on specific industries or technologies allows MSPs to refine their skills and deliver customized solutions. Specialization also helps streamline marketing efforts, making it easier to connect with the right clients.

"When you have authority, people will pay attention. When you are perceived as a subject matter expert, people will naturally want to work with you. They will seek you out."

Maintaining expertise requires ongoing learning, staying updated on trends, and gathering client feedback. By positioning themselves as experts, MSPs can attract clients more easily and reduce the need for constant outreach efforts.

Creating Expert Content That Converts

Once you've established your expertise, the next step is turning it into content that drives interest and generates leads. Create materials that highlight your MSP's knowledge and provide actionable insights for decision-makers. This type of content builds trust over time and helps attract potential clients.

Writing Content That Stands Out

Effective expert content tackles industry challenges with in-depth technical knowledge, while staying easy to understand for decision-makers.

Here are a few formats to consider:

  • Technical Guides: Step-by-step instructions for tackling complex IT topics.
  • Industry Analysis: Insights into new technologies and trends.
  • Video Tutorials: Visual walkthroughs of technical processes.

Share Client Success Stories

Case studies are a great way to show your expertise in action. When creating them, include:

  • The Challenge: Clearly describe the business problem and any limitations.
  • The Solution: Explain your technical approach and how it was implemented.
  • The Results: Highlight measurable outcomes like cost savings or improved efficiency.

Organize a Content Calendar

Use a content calendar to plan and schedule posts based on your audience's interests and the best times for engagement.

Stick to a rotating schedule, such as:

  • Week 1: Analysis of industry news with expert insights.
  • Week 2: A case study or client success story.
  • Week 3: A technical tip or best practice guide.

Focus on 3–5 key themes to ensure your content remains consistent and thorough. Collaborate with partners to expand the reach of your materials.

Building Trust Through Partnerships

Leveraging partnerships can strengthen your MSP's credibility by providing external validation and expanding your reach.

Finding the Right Business Partners

Teaming up with local chambers of commerce can be a smart move - businesses that are members tend to grow five times faster than those that aren't.

Here are a few ways to create effective partnerships:

  • Host educational events with local business groups
  • Develop co-branded technical resources
  • Organize webinar series that tackle industry-specific challenges

These collaborations not only expand your audience but also help you get more mileage out of your content. For example, joint webinars can introduce your expertise to fresh audiences.

Getting and Using Client Feedback

Client testimonials are more influential than ever. In 2023, 78% of marketers used them in their strategy, up from 67% in 2022. Combine testimonials with case studies to showcase real-world results. To make the process easier, request feedback right after key milestones. Video testimonials are especially effective - 89% of consumers prefer them.

"Customer testimonials and case studies are crucial tools in connecting with B2B buyers. By soliciting feedback from satisfied clients, you craft compelling narratives that resonate with potential buyers, fostering trust and driving sustainable growth." - Samuel Thimothy, OneIMS

Speaking at Industry Events

Speaking engagements can enhance your reputation and generate leads. Webinars are particularly effective - 82% of attendees are more likely to buy from a company after attending one.

For example, Rapid7 hosted a cybersecurity workshop series in 2018. This not only established them as industry leaders but also helped them attract high-quality leads.

Tracking Expert Status Progress

Once you've put your content, partnerships, and Cadyen-based strategies into action, it's important to track your progress. Here's how to measure your growth effectively.

Key Performance Metrics

To assess how your MSP's authority is evolving, keep an eye on these indicators:

  • Website performance: Monitor traffic and rankings using tools like Google Analytics and Search Console.
  • Social media activity: Track likes, comments, and shares to gauge audience engagement.
  • Email growth: Measure your subscriber list's expansion.
  • Content interaction: Check downloads of resources like whitepapers and ebooks.
  • Backlinks: Evaluate the volume and quality of links to your site.
  • Speaking opportunities: Count invitations to present at events.
  • Podcast appearances: Track how often you're asked to be a guest.
  • Media recognition: Note mentions in industry publications.
  • Industry connections: Look at how many sector leaders follow or engage with you.
